happystarpoints.pngEveryone likes free stuff. It’s, well, free; so how about 600,000 Starpoints? They could be yours, in all their pointy glory, if you win Starwood’s Grand Tour contest. Of course, you have to be a Starwood Preferred Guest Member—natch—but they can be redeemed anywhere they are accepted if you win ‘em. Just fill out a survey and you’re entered in the Sweepstakes, with Ed McMahon nowhere to be found.

All that pointage spells multiple nights at several different Starwood properties with airfare. So, you could hypothetically get 14 nights in Tahiti plus airfare and seven nights at the Westin in St. John, and still have a boatload of points left over. Now if only Nobu took Starpoints…
